Author and source

Description
English: Performer: Frank Croxton († 3 December 1949)

Title/Work: Rocked in the cradle of the deep
Content: Basso solo, orchestra accompaniment
Composer: Joseph Philip Knight (1812-1887)
Lyricists: Emma Willard (1787-1870)
Genre: Pop music 1910s
Recording date: 1913

Release date: 1913
